stink to high heaven
stink to high heaven Also,
smell to high heaven. Be of very poor quality; also, be suspect or in bad repute. For example,
This plan of yours stinks to high heaven, or
His financial schemes smell to high heaven; I'm sure they're dishonest. This expression alludes to something so rank that it can be smelled from a great distance. [c. 1600]
